Professional PPF installation costs $1,500-6,000. DIY pre-cut kits for the front bumper + hood + mirrors run $250-500 in materials — and the process is genuinely learnable in one weekend if you follow the right sequence.

What PPF Actually Is

PPF (Paint Protection Film) is a 6-8 mil thick urethane film that adheres to painted surfaces via a semi-permanent adhesive. It absorbs rock chips, road debris impacts, minor abrasions, and light chemical exposure. Self-healing PPF (most modern films) uses heat to erase minor scratches in the film itself — direct sun or hair dryer heat “resets” the film’s smooth surface.

Where PPF Is Actually Worth It

Full-car PPF costs $3,500-8,000 pro. Full DIY is possible but not recommended for first-timers. Focus on high-impact areas that give 80% of the protection benefit for 20% of the cost:

Highest-value areas (do these first)

  • Front bumper — takes 90% of rock chips
  • Hood leading edge (12 inches back) — highway rock chip zone
  • Front fenders — chip catchers
  • Side mirrors — get hit by everything
  • A-pillars (windshield frame edges) — highway bug residue etches paint here

Medium-value areas

  • Full hood
  • Door edges (from other cars in parking lots)
  • Rocker panels (road spray)
  • Trunk lip (from bags being placed)

Low-value areas (usually not worth it)

  • Roof (only makes sense if you regularly drive under low branches)
  • Quarter panels (rarely hit by anything)

Pre-Cut Kit vs Bulk Film

Films are cut on a plotter to fit your specific vehicle’s panels. You get a bag of pre-shaped pieces. Much easier to install because no measuring or cutting.

Bulk film — For irregular shapes or full car

You cut the film yourself. Requires plotter or careful hand-cutting. Not recommended for first attempt.

Materials & Tools

DIY slip solution recipe (saves $20-30)

1 gallon distilled water + 1-2 drops of baby shampoo. That’s it. Commercial slip solutions are 95% water + surfactant. Baby shampoo is the safest surfactant for PPF adhesive.

Prep — 60% of Install Quality

PPF only sticks to a completely clean, decontaminated surface. Skipping prep is why DIY installs fail.

Prep sequence

  1. Wash the vehicle with pH-neutral soap. Rinse thoroughly.
  2. Iron decon spray + rinse (removes brake dust particles that would show through film).
  3. Clay bar the panels getting PPF (removes bonded contaminants).
  4. Wipe with 70% isopropyl alcohol on lint-free microfiber. This is critical — removes any waxes, sealants, or polishes that would prevent adhesion.
  5. Repeat IPA wipe with a fresh, clean cloth.
  6. Do NOT touch the prepped surface with bare hands — skin oils prevent adhesion. Use nitrile gloves.
  7. Move to a garage or shaded, wind-free area. Dust in the air = dust under film = permanent imperfection.

Installation Process — Front Bumper Example

Phase 1: Position (10-15 min)

  1. Peel about 6 inches of backing off the film’s top edge.
  2. Spray the exposed adhesive side with slip solution (soaks the adhesive — makes it repositionable).
  3. Spray the vehicle’s paint with slip solution (creates a “swimming” layer).
  4. Place the film on the panel — because both surfaces are wet with slip, the film glides for positioning.
  5. Align edges — reference the pre-cut piece’s shape to the panel’s features (headlight, license plate cutouts, etc.).
  6. Once aligned, the slip solution begins to dissipate and the adhesive starts to grab.

Phase 2: Central Squeegee (15-25 min)

  1. Starting at the center of the panel, squeegee outward with firm, overlapping strokes.
  2. Use a hard squeegee for flat areas, soft squeegee for curves.
  3. Push all slip solution and air bubbles out toward the edges.
  4. Work in overlapping ~60° arcs, never lift and reset — always maintain contact.
  5. Bubbles that don’t want to squeegee out: lift the film corner slightly, spray more slip, re-squeegee.

Phase 3: Heat & Wrap Curves (20-40 min)

  1. For curved sections (bumper corners, headlight surrounds), heat the film with the heat gun on low (250-300°F).
  2. Heat makes the film pliable — it stretches to conform to compound curves.
  3. Stretch gently and squeegee simultaneously. Don’t force it — micro-tears form under too much stretch.
  4. For sharp inside corners, use a razor-sharp blade to make relief cuts. Overlap the resulting flaps and heat to bond.

Phase 4: Edge Tucking (15-25 min)

Where film meets a panel edge (behind bumper, into wheel arch), you need to tuck the excess:

  1. Heat the film edge until pliable.
  2. Use a squeegee wrapped in microfiber (protects the paint) to push the excess film underneath the panel edge.
  3. The adhesive bonds it to the underside — invisible from front view.

Phase 5: Trim Excess (10-15 min)

If the pre-cut kit left extra material, trim with a fresh blade:

  1. Position the blade perpendicular to the film.
  2. Cut in one smooth motion — don’t saw back and forth.
  3. Use very light pressure — you’re cutting film, not paint.

Phase 6: Cure (24-72 hours)

The adhesive continues to bond for 24-72 hours after install:

  • No water contact for 48 hours (no rain, no car wash)
  • Small bubbles under the film may evaporate over the first 48 hours — don’t try to squeegee them out immediately
  • Full adhesion in 5-7 days

Common Failures

Bubbles that won’t go away

Cause: dirt or dust trapped under film during install. Fix: puncture with a fresh #11 blade (poke, don’t cut), squeegee out. Small bubbles usually invisible; large ones require film replacement.

Film peels at edges within a month

Cause: skipped IPA prep, or oil/wax contamination. Fix: remove that section, reprep, reinstall (or use liquid PPF sealer on edges).

Fingerprints visible under film

Cause: touched the paint or adhesive with bare hands. Fix: remove that section, reprep, reinstall. Preventable with nitrile gloves.

Film cracks in cold weather

Cause: over-stretched during install (thinner than designed). Fix: replace section. Prevention: work slowly, use more heat instead of more stretch.

Yellow discoloration after 2-3 years

Cause: cheap film without proper UV inhibitors. Fix: replace with better brand (XPEL, 3M). Prevention: buy quality film upfront.

Time Estimates

  • Front bumper (pre-cut): 60-90 minutes for a first-time installer
  • Hood (partial or full): 90 minutes to 2.5 hours
  • Full front-end kit (bumper + hood + fenders + mirrors + A-pillars): 6-10 hours spread over 1-2 days
  • Full car: 20-40 hours (not recommended for first attempt)

What DIY Actually Delivers

First-time DIY: 85-92% of pro quality. Second/third attempt: 95%+. Under close inspection at 6 inches, you’ll see slight edge alignment differences vs. pro install. From 5 feet, indistinguishable.

The tradeoff: $300-500 in supplies vs. $2,000-4,000 pro install for the front end. Saves $1,500-3,500 for the same functional protection.

Frequently Asked Questions

Can I install PPF outside?

Only if it’s a still, overcast day with low humidity. Any breeze blows dust onto the panel; any sun bakes the slip solution off too fast. Garage installation strongly preferred.

Do I need to remove wheels and bumpers?

For pro-quality results, yes. Removing the bumper cover lets you wrap edges cleanly and hide the film’s edge lines. For DIY on daily drivers, most people skip this and accept minor edge visibility.

How long does PPF last?

Quality film (XPEL, 3M, SunTek): 7-10 years. Budget film: 3-5 years. All PPF eventually yellows and needs replacement.

Can I wash and wax over PPF?

Yes — treat it like normal paint. Avoid abrasive polishes and rubbing compounds directly on PPF (they can dull the film). Ceramic coating over PPF is compatible and extends the film’s life.
